The images are unfortunately missing from many of the older posts on this forum.
You can download the workshop manual AKD530 as a free pdf download here:
https://www.dorsetmmoc.co.uk/wordpress/ ... manual.pdf
Then you can view it on your computer and print out the pages that you need for a particular job.
There is a wiring diagram N46 for models with an alternator in the workshop manual but it is not very useful because it is for the very early alternators that had an external 4TR control unit and they were positive earth as well.
For your 1967 car the relevant diagram is N44 remembering that this diagram is for a POSITIVE earth car and by necessity your car will be NEGATIVE earth with a modern alternator. This diagram does not include the alternator wiring as it is for a dynamo.
